What is a junior software engineer?

A junior software engineer works on a team with more senior engineers to help design and develop applications, write code, and otherwise maintain or update a business's database. As a junior software engineer, your duties and responsibilities may vary based on what company you work for. Overall, your job is to learn from senior engineers and developers on how to be a software engineer and in what ways you can develop and utilize the technologies of the business to do so. Many junior software engineers have a little bit of knowledge about a lot of technologies but also stay up-to-date on the most current technologies.

How does a junior software engineer typically collaborate with other team members on projects?

Junior Software Engineers usually work closely with senior developers, QA testers, and product managers as part of a cross-functional team. Collaboration often involves participating in daily stand-up meetings, code reviews, and pair programming sessions. Juniors are encouraged to ask questions and seek feedback, which helps them learn best practices and improve their coding skills. Effective communication and a willingness to learn from more experienced colleagues are key to thriving in this collaborative environment.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a junior software eng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Junior Software Engineer, you need a solid understanding of programming fundamentals, algorithms, and commonly used languages such as Java, Python, or JavaScript, typically backed by a degree in computer science or related field. Familiarity with version control systems like Git, basic knowledge of databases, and experience with development environments and frameworks are usually expected. Strong problem-solving skills, eagerness to learn, and effective teamwork and communication abilities help set you apart. These skills and qualities are crucial for contributing effectively to projects, adapting to evolving technologies, and collaborating within development teams.
